The lodge’s location in Sutton upon Derwent is ideal for discovering the area’s many attractions. The magnificent city of York is just a short journey away, where you can marvel at the iconic York Minster (9.5 miles), delve into the city’s past at the Jorvik Viking Centre (9 miles), or simply enjoy its vibrant collection of shops, bars, and restaurants. For a day of retail therapy, the McArthur Glen designer outlet is also 9.5 miles from your door. If you’re keen to embrace the great outdoors, the stunning landscapes of the Howardian Hills (21 miles) offer wonderful walking opportunities and breathtaking views.
